A cat's tail can be held high, low, puffed up, or swishing rapidly. A high tail indicates a happy or confident cat, while a low tail can signal fear or submission. A puffed-up tail suggests aggression or being startled, and a rapidly swishing tail may indicate irritation or agitation.

Why do cats' tail twitches and what does it indicate about their behavior?

Cats' tail twitches are a form of communication that can indicate their mood and intentions. A twitching tail can signal agitation, excitement, or readiness to pounce. It is important to pay attention to a cat's tail movements to better understand their behavior and avoid potential conflicts.

What is the significance of a cat's curved tail and what does it mean in terms of their behavior and communication?

A cat's curved tail is a key part of their body language and communication. When a cat's tail is curved, it can indicate various emotions and intentions. For example, a curved tail held high may signal confidence or excitement, while a low curved tail could indicate fear or submission. Cats also use their curved tails to communicate with other cats and humans, showing their mood and intentions through different tail positions. Understanding a cat's tail language can help us better interpret their behavior and respond appropriately.

Why is my cat licking my other cats, and is this behavior normal or should I be concerned?

Cats lick each other as a form of social bonding and grooming. This behavior is normal and shows affection between cats. However, excessive licking or changes in behavior could indicate stress or health issues, so it's important to monitor their interactions and consult a veterinarian if needed.
